0
當我更新一些hightcharts圖片時,我正面臨着highcharts-ng指令的問題。當我使用這個syntaxe圖表就像魅力的更新,但似乎並沒有表現出任何我的數據標籤:更新時出現問題Highcharts對象使用highcharts-ng指令
$scope.chartRonConfig = {
chart: {
plotBackgroundColor: null,
plotBorderWidth: 0,
plotShadow: false
},
title: {
text: 'Browser<br>skjdfhsjdkf<br>2019',
align: 'center',
verticalAlign: 'middle',
y: 40
},
tooltip: {
pointFormat: '{series.name}: <b>{point.percentage:.1f}%</b>'
},
plotOptions: {
pie: {
dataLabels: {
enabled: true,
distance: -50,
style: {
fontWeight: 'bold',
color: 'white'
}
},
startAngle: -90,
endAngle: 90,
center: ['50%', '75%']
}
},
series: [{
type: 'pie',
name: 'Browser share',
innerSize: '50%',
data: [
['Firefox', 10.38],
['IE', 56.33],
['Chrome', 24.03],
['Safari', 4.77],
['Opera', 0.91],
{
name: 'Proprietary or Undetectable',
y: 0.2,
dataLabels: {
enabled: false
}
}
]
}]
};
但使用這種syntaxe時,即時通訊:
$scope.chartRonConfig = Highcharts.chart('RonContainer', { // same config }
沒有什麼更新。
的觀點很簡單:
<highchart id="RonContainer" config="chartRonConfig"></highchart>
我不知道我錯過了什麼我在這裏。任何幫助,將不勝感激。
與highcharts-ng的從內存中,你可以只運行更新$範圍變量來編輯標題,你可以有一個功能,當被稱爲例如更新標題$ scope.chartRonConfig.title.text ='hello world' – Tik
是的,但爲什麼當我啓動圖表時沒有顯示數據標籤?! –
您是否可以在jsfiddle.net上覆制您的示例作爲現場演示?它將允許我們調試它。從圖像中很難預測原因。 –